Welcome to our complete guide to getting started in digital photography! In an age where smartphones and digital cameras have become accessible to everyone, photography has become a popular way to capture and share precious moments. Whether you’re a complete beginner or want to improve your skills, this guide will take you through the fundamentals of digital photography and help you experiment and discover your photographic talent. Know your digital camera

  • Types of digital cameras: DSLR, mirrorless, compact.
  • Camera components: lens, sensor, viewfinder, display, buttons and settings.
  • Correct setting of your camera: automatic mode, manual mode and other preset modes.

Fundamentals of photography

  • Exposure: aperture, exposure time and ISO sensitivity.
  • Depth of Field: Control the sharpness and blur of the image.
  • White Balance: Get accurate colors under different lighting conditions.
  • Composition: rule of thirds, guidelines, focal points.

Lighting and light

  • Natural Light: Take advantage of sunlight in different weather conditions.
  • Artificial light: use flashes, continuous lights and light modifiers.
  • Shadow and highlight control to get a well-balanced image.

Shooting technique

  • Focus: Auto and manual focus modes.
  • Image stabilization: the importance of a tripod or a steady hand.
  • Burst Shooting: Capture fast action and movement.

Post production

  • Importance of editing software: Adobe Lightroom, Photoshop and free alternatives.
  • Color correction and exposure balancing.
  • Image retouching and enhancement: sharpening, noise reduction, blemish correction.
